IDCODE: A command can be set in SDIR by the H-UDI pins to place the H-UDI pins in the
IDCODE mode stipulated by JTAG. When the H-UDI is initialized (TRST is asserted or TAP is in
the Test-Logic-Reset state), the IDCODE mode is entered.
CLAMP, HIGHZ: A command can be set in SDIR by the H-UDI pins to place the H-UDI pins in
the CLAMP or HIGHZ mode stipulated by JTAG.
19.5.2 Points for Attention
• Boundary scan mode does not cover clock-related signals (EXTAL, XTAL, CKIO, and
CK_PHY).
• Boundary scan mode does not cover system- and E10A-related signals (RES and ASEMD).
• Boundary scan mode does not cover H-UDI-related signals (TCK, TDI, TDO, TMS, and
TRST).
• When the EXTEST, CLAMP, and HIGHZ commands are set, fix the RES pin low.
• When a boundary scan test for other than BYPASS and IDCODE is carried out, fix the
ASEMD pin high.
19.6 Usage Notes
• An H-UDI command, once set, will not be modified as long as another command is not re-
issued from the H-UDI. If the same command is given continuously, the command must be set
after a command (BYPASS, etc.) that does not affect LSI operations is once set.
• Because LSI operations are suspended in standby mode, H-UDI commands are not accepted.
To hold the state of the TAP before and after standby mode, the TCK signal must be high
during standby mode transition.
• The H-UDI is used for emulator connection. Therefore, H-UDI functions cannot be used when
using an emulator.
